After lots of thought (and a little heartbreak), we’ve officially changed our name from Yaki Yaki to Sip & Smile 💚
Yaki Yaki has been with us since day one in 2023, and we’re so grateful for the memories—but since we no longer sell Taiyaki, we felt it was time for a fresh start that reflects what we do best: serving drinks that make you smile ☀️🍵
Same vibes, same faces, same matcha you love—just a new name to match our journey 💫
